Clarks Hours of Operation and Locations in Narragansett, RI
- 1 Locations in Narragansett
- clarkbrands.com
- Clarks Hours
- Category: Accessories Electronics Shoes
-
889 Boston Neck RdView Store Details
(401) 792-2204
Explore NarragansettView More
-
Apparel
Marshalls
Carter's
Catherines
Dots
Journeys
-
Sports
Sports Authority
Vans
West Marine
-
Jewelry
Marshalls